Pompeii
Upon arrival in Pompeii, you’ll step back in time and explore the incredible remnants of this once-thriving Roman city, buried and preserved under volcanic ash for nearly two millennia. The ruins of Pompeii offer one of the best-preserved examples of daily life in Ancient Rome. Sightseeing in Pompeii is an unforgettable experience, with highlights including:
The Forum – The centre of public life in Pompeii, where you can see the remains of important civic buildings and temples, including the Temple of Jupiter and the Basilica.
The Amphitheatre – One of the oldest and best-preserved Roman amphitheatres in the world, where gladiators once entertained crowds.
The House of the Vettii – A beautifully preserved Roman home, showcasing vibrant frescoes and mosaics that give insight into the lavish lifestyle of Pompeii’s elite.
The Baths – The public baths, which were once a hub of social life in the city, are among the best-preserved structures in Pompeii.
The Casts of the Victims – The haunting plaster casts of victims, preserved in the moment of their death during the eruption, provide a powerful and emotional reminder of the city’s tragic fate.
